Donovan Mitchell over 28.5 Points (-118 FanDuel)
Cavaliers guard Donovan Mitchell is putting together another outstanding season, averaging a career-high 30.6 points and shooting nearly 51% from the field. He is making more than 39% of his three-pointers while attempting more than 10 of them per game. Mitchell torched the Pacers for 43 points in his last game and has now scored 40+ points in two of his last three games.

Tonight's matchup sets up as another smash spot for Mitchell. Portland has played at the third-fastest pace in the league this season, and its defensive rating sits just 21st. They are also still without one of the elite perimeter defenders in the league in Jrue Holiday. The Cavs also play at a top-10 pace, so there should be a few extra possessions in this game, and that likely means a few extra shot attempts for Mitchell.
Nicolas Claxton over 23.5 Points + Rebounds (-103 DraftKings)
The Brooklyn Nets have been one of the worst teams in the league this season, but they may have a matchup they can exploit to help them remain competitive in this contest. Center Nic Claxton is coming off a double-double performance last game against Charlotte in which he posted 13 points and 11 rebounds. The big man played 33 minutes in that game, showing Brooklyn's willingness to extend Claxton when he is playing well. He gets an elite matchup tonight and should be able to have similar success.
The Bulls have lost their last four games, and the competition hasn't been all that difficult. Three of those losses came to the Pelicans, Hornets, and Pacers, who are among the worst teams in the league. Their defensive rating has slipped to 22nd, and they play at the second-fastest pace in the league. Chicago has also allowed the most points in the paint this season, where Claxton is scoring 69% of his points this season and more than 80% for his career. The matchup sets up perfectly for Claxton, and the struggles of the Bulls recently should keep this game close enough for Claxton to flirt with another double-double.

Anthony Black over 21.5 Points + Rebounds + Assists (-120 Fanatics)
The Magic remain without Paolo Banchero, but the star's absence has allowed other players the opportunity to step into larger roles. No one has capitalized on that opportunity more than third-year man Anthony Black. The Arkansas product has taken a massive step forward in his development this year and is averaging career-highs across the board.
The first game after Banchero went down with an injury, Black struggled with just two points in 16 minutes. In eight games since then, Black has averaged a massive 31.1 minutes, 18.1 points, 3.6 rebounds, and 3.6 assists (or 25.3 PRA).
He gets a matchup against a Spurs team that is playing on the second night of a back-to-back and will still be down two elite defenders in Victor Wembanyama and Stephon Castle. Black should be able to continue this amazing run with a strong performance over the Spurs.
Jay Huff over 15.5 Points + Rebounds (-112 FanDuel)
The Indiana Pacers have used a rotating cast of players at the center position all season long, but it appears they may have found something in Jay Huff. The 7'1'' Virginia product has started each of the last three games, and the results have to be encouraging for the Pacers. Huff has averaged 24.3 minutes, 13.7 points, and 5.7 rebounds in those starts, and he leads the league with 2.3 blocks per game. It is easily the best production they have seen from the position this season.

The Pacers have tried out Isaiah Jackson, who struggles to stay healthy and often finds himself in foul trouble, and they have aging Tony Bradley. Huff should be able to maintain a firm grasp on his starting role, and that likely means around 25 minutes of playing time.
Huff has three-time MVP Nikola Jokic on the other side of this matchup, but the books have been a bit slow to adjust to the new role for Huff. Even in this difficult spot, Huff should be able to rack up at least 16 combined points and rebounds.
Davion Mitchell over 6.5 Assists (-138 Caesars)
Heat guard Davion Mitchell has been playing excellent basketball on both ends of the floor. With Tyler Herro and Bam Adebayo back in the lineup, the Heat are virtually back to full strength for the first time this season. Mitchell has been able to settle into a facilitator role over the last four games playing alongside Herro, and he has seen his assist rate spike as a result. Mitchell has posted at least nine assists in each of the last three games. His worst game playing alongside Herro happened to be in this same matchup he gets today against Dallas. Perhaps that is why the line is sitting at just 6.5 assists.
For the season, Mitchell has averaged 7.8 assists. The Heat and Mavs both play at a top-6 pace, so there should be plenty of extra possessions. Dallas has been a strong defense this season and does have Anthony Davis back in the lineup, but Mitchell should still be able to post at least seven assists.
